Description
100Base-T4 Capable
Set to 0 all the time to indicate that the PHY841F does not support
100Base-T4.
100Base-X Full Duplex Capable
Set to 1 all the time to indicate that the PHY841F does support Full
Duplex mode.
100Base-X Half Duplex Capable
Set to 1 all the time to indicate that the PHY841F does support Half
Duplex mode
10M Full Duplex Capable
TP: Set to 1 all the time to indicate that the PHY841F does support 10M
Full Duplex mode.
FX: Set to 0 all the time to indicate that the PHY841F does not support
10M Full Duplex mode
10M Half Duplex Capable
TP: Set to 1 all the time to indicate that the PHY841F does support 10M
Half Duplex mode.
FX: Set to 0 all the time to indicate that the PHY841F does not support
10M Half Duplex mode
100Base-T2 Capable
Set to 0 all the time to indicate that the PHY841F does not support
100Base-T2.
Reserved
Not Applicable
MF Preamble Suppression Capable
This bit is hardwired to 1 indicating that the PHY841F accepts
management frame without preamble. Minimum 32 preamble bits are
required following power-on or hardware reset. One idle bit is required
between any two management transactions as per IEEE 802.3u
specification.
Auto Negotiation Complete
If auto negotiation is enabled, this bit indicates whether the auto
negotiation process has been completed or not.
Set to 0 all the time when Fiber Mode is selected.
